Snowflake Database Administrator

4 weeks ago


Peoria, United States Caterpillar Full time
Career Area:
Business Technologies, Digital and Data
Job Description:

Your Work Shapes the World at Caterpillar Inc.

When you join Caterpillar, you're joining a global team who cares not just about the work we do - but also about each other. We are the makers, problem solvers, and future world builders who are creating stronger, more sustainable communities. We don't just talk about progress and innovation here - we make it happen, with our customers, where we work and live. Together, we are building a better world, so we can all enjoy living in it.

Snowflake Database Administrator

Role Definition:

As a Snowflake Database Administrator, you will be primarily responsible for ensuring the integrity, security, and performance of the Data platform that supports the data needs of various business units and functions.

You will work closely with the Enterprise Data Governance team and the Business Governance team to follow the standards and principles of data management and governance.

You will also collaborate with data engineers, data analysts, data scientists, and other stakeholders to provide data solutions that meet the business requirements and objectives.

What You Wil Do:
  • Manage and monitor the Snowflake platform, including data ingestion, data transformation, data quality, data security, and data access.
  • Apply the principles and policies that have been agreed with the Business Governance team regarding data source ingestion, database functional organization, and access management.
  • Implement and enforce best practices for data modeling, data architecture, data governance, and data lifecycle management.
  • Troubleshoot and resolve any issues or incidents related to the Snowflake platform and provide root cause analysis and recommendations for improvement.
  • Provide technical support and guidance to data users and consumers and ensure that they have the appropriate access and permissions to the data they need.
  • Review and approve code changes as part of the CI/CD process.
  • Maintain and update our CI/CD Python package as required.
  • Collaborate with Enterprise Data Lakes to ensure efficient data flows.
  • Keep abreast of the latest developments and trends in Snowflake and other data technologies and evaluate and recommend new features or tools that can enhance the data capabilities and performance.
  • Lead actions to maintain the infrastructure of IT systems that support the business to function efficiently.
  • Guide the design solutions by assessing and aligning the current systems to best practices and comply to federal policies and procedures.
  • Execute the middleware application server and automated workflow tools, work with server virtualization technologies.
  • Administer updates, upgrades, and other maintenance tasks in both hardware and software areas, to make the network more efficient, cost-effective, and secure.
What You Have:
  • Bachelor's degree in computer science, Information Systems, or a related field, or equivalent work experience.
  • At least 3 years of experience as a Snowflake Database Administrator, or a similar role in data management and administration.
  • Strong knowledge and skills in Snowflake, including data ingestion, data transformation, data security, data access, and data optimization.
  • Experience with data governance and data quality frameworks and tools, such as Data Catalog, Data Lineage, Data Dictionary, and Data Profiling.
  • Experience with SQL and scripting languages, such as Python, JavaScript, Shell, or PowerShell.
  • Excellent communication, collaboration, and critical thinking skills.
  • Ability to work independently and as part of a team in a fast-paced and dynamic environment.
  • Certification in Snowflake or other data technologies is a plus.
Skills Descriptors:

Technical Excellence: Knowledge of a given technology and various application methods; ability to develop and provide solutions to significant technical challenges.

Level Extensive Experience:
  • •Advises others on the assessment and provision of all technical solutions.
  • •Engages appropriate subject matter resources to effectively resolve technical issues.
  • •Mentors' others to enhance their technical competence and its application to achieve more effective technical solutions.
  • •Provides effective solutions to moderate technical challenges through strong technical competence, effectively examining implications of events and issues.
  • •Assumes accountability for personal technical performance and holds others responsible for theirs.
Technology Advising: Knowledge of effective advisory methods and ability to provide valued information and advice to clients regarding products, technologies, services, and solutions for a specific technology domain.

Level Working Knowledge:
  • Assesses the current technology environment, expressed needs and initiatives of client organizations.
  • Demonstrates basic competence and sound business knowledge regarding specific products, technologies, or services within a domain of technology expertise.
  • Achieves consulting relationship rating of 'professional' by delivering timely, meaningful advice meeting client needs in a narrow set of specific technologies.
Hardware Infrastructure: Knowledge of computer architecture and systems programming; ability to design, build and integrate IT hardware into multi-platforms for the organization.

Level Extensive Experience:
  • Evaluates IT hardware vendors in the market and selects the most suitable products for the organization.
  • Guides employees on the integration of IT hardware throughout other organization-wide platforms.
  • Supervises the implementation process of IT hardware ensuring consistency in productivity and overall effectiveness.
  • Advises others on business standards and practices for IT hardware to meet designer requirements.
  • Evaluates the advantages and disadvantages of an organization's hardware components.
  • Diagnoses IT hardware problems and recommends dynamic solutions.
Requirements Analysis: Knowledge of tools, methods, and techniques of requirement analysis; ability to elicit, analyze and record required business functionality and non-functionality requirements to ensure the success of a system or software development project.

Level Working Knowledge:
  • Follows policies, practices, and standards for determining functional and informational requirements.
  • Communicates with customers and users to elicit and gather client requirements.
  • Participates in the preparation of detailed documentation and requirements.
System Testing: Knowledge of system and software testing; ability to design, plan and execute system testing strategies and tactics to ensure the quality of software at all stages of the system life cycle.

Level Extensive Experience:
  • Verifies the proper flow of transactions across all input, output and storage channels or devices.
  • Evaluates interoperability of new systems with existing systems during the beta testing phase.
  • Supervises the testing of complex, multi-platform, and distributed applications.
  • Designs processes to ensure that the system meets and maintains requirements and expectations.
  • Coaches end users on the development of test data and test scenarios for system validation.
  • Manages the execution of test plans, including resources, strategies, schedules, processes, and tools.
Systems Software Infrastructure: Knowledge of computer architecture and system software interaction; ability to design and build a fundamental architecture of operating systems, database management systems, communications protocols, compilers, and other development tools.

Level Working Knowledge:
  • Demonstrates planned software changes on the local environment.
  • Analyzes the local software architecture components and products.
  • Tests key features for the entire software infrastructure environment.
Technical Troubleshooting: Knowledge of technical troubleshooting approaches, tools, and techniques; ability to anticipate, recognize, and resolve technical issues on hardware, software, application or operation.

Level Extensive Experience:
  • Emphasizes the business impact of failure and the criticality and timing of needed resolution so that problems can be avoided in the future.
  • Creates trouble reports for all issues found and reviews solutions for completeness and correctness.
  • Directs the resolution of communications problems in multi-vendor environments.
  • Resolves a variety of hardware, software, and communications malfunctions.
  • Coaches' others on advanced diagnostic techniques and tools for unusual or performance-related problems.
  • Facilitates the distribution of releases reports and correction packages to departments or clients.
Technical Writing/Documentation: Knowledge of technical writing; ability to write technical documents such as manuals, reports, guidelines or documents on standards, processes, and applications.

Level Extensive Experience:
  • Conducts training on alternative documentation delivery mechanisms, tools, and techniques.
  • Manages cost items in producing and maintaining documentation.
  • Designs and implements formal methodologies for producing documentation.
  • Collaborates with support function managers, the product management team, and design engineers with writing projects.
  • Supervises the analysis, design, and data collation on large documentation initiatives.
  • Establishes and references best practices for existing and planned tools and delivery vehicles for proper documentation.
Additional Information:
  • Location: Peoria, IL, Dallas, TX or Nashville, TN
  • NO RELOCATION
  • 3days MANDATORY IN OFFICE
  • Sponsorship is not available including OPT, H4-EAD. Must be US Citizen or Green Card holder.
What You Will Get:
  • Our goal at Caterpillar is for you to have a rewarding career. Our teams are critical to the success of our customers who build a better world.
  • Here you earn more than just an hourly wage because we value your performance, we offer a total rewards package that provides day one benefits (medical, dental, vision, RX, and 401K) along with the potential of an annual bonus.
  • Additional benefits include paid vacation days and paid holidays (prorated based upon hire date).
About Caterpillar:
  • Caterpillar Inc. is the world's leading manufacturer of construction and mining equipment, off-highway diesel and natural gas engines, industrial gas turbines and diesel-electric locomotives. For nearly 100 years, we've been helping customers build a better, more sustainable world and are committed and contributing to a reduced-carbon future. Our innovative products and services, backed by our global dealer network, provide exceptional value that helps customers succeed.
Visa Sponsorship is not available for this position. This employer is not currently hiring foreign national applicants that require or will require sponsorship tied to a specific employer, such as, H, L, TN, F, J, E, O. As a global company, Caterpillar offers many job opportunities outside of the U.S which can be found through our employment website at www.caterpillar.com/careers.
Posting Dates:
October 15, 2024 - October 28, 2024
Any offer of employment is conditioned upon the successful completion of a drug screen.

EEO/AA Employer. All qualified individuals - Including minorities, females, veterans and individuals with disabilities - are encouraged to apply.

Not ready to apply? Join our Talent Community .PandoLogic. Category: , Keywords: Database Administrator (DBA)

  • Peoria, Illinois, United States Caterpillar Full time

    About the RoleCaterpillar is seeking a highly skilled Snowflake Database Administrator to join our team. As a key member of our data platform team, you will be responsible for ensuring the integrity, security, and performance of our data platform.Key ResponsibilitiesManage and monitor the Snowflake platform, including data ingestion, data transformation,...


  • Peoria, United States Caterpillar Full time

    Career Area: Business Technologies, Digital and Data Job Description: Your Work Shapes the World at Caterpillar Inc. When you join Caterpillar, you're joining a global team who cares not just about the work we do - but also about each other. We are the makers, problem solvers, and future world builders who are creating stronger, more sustainable...


  • Peoria, Illinois, United States Illinois Mutual Life Insurance Company Full time

    Job SummaryThe Illinois Mutual Life Insurance Company seeks a highly skilled Senior Database Administrator to provide technical support for the database environment, oversee the development and organization of the Company's databases, and implement new technologies to drive business growth.This role requires a strong understanding of database technology,...


  • Peoria, Illinois, United States Illinois Mutual Life Insurance Company Full time

    Job DescriptionAt Illinois Mutual Life Insurance Company, we are seeking a highly skilled Database Administrator to join our team. The successful candidate will be responsible for providing technical support for our database environments, organizing our databases, and implementing new technologies to improve our data management capabilities.Key...

  • Python Developer

    4 weeks ago


    Peoria, Illinois, United States CATERPILLAR INC Full time

    Job DescriptionCareer Area: Business Technologies, Digital and DataJob Title: Python DeveloperJob Summary:We are seeking a highly skilled Python Developer to join our team in Peoria, IL, Dallas, TX, or Nashville, TN. As a Python Developer, you will be responsible for maintaining our Python ETL package and developing new functionalities.Key...

  • Application Support

    3 weeks ago


    Peoria, United States TEKsystems Full time

    Description: Position’s Contributions to Work Group: - Triage & Resolve support tickets as per the defined Service Level agreement - Works on critical application/technical problem identification and resolution, including responding to off-shift and weekend support calls. - Tickets investigation; statistical analyses, testing and analysis of application...


  • Peoria, United States JR Filanc Construction Company Full time

    Essential Functions: Provide administrative and project support to the Arizona R&M General Manager, Project Managers, Field Superintendents and Field Employees as needed with confidentiality and professionalism. Responsibilities: Office Administration Manage all calls and correspondence for the Arizona office. Check and sort mail daily. Receive and...


  • Peoria, Illinois, United States Elite Mente LLC Full time

    Job DescriptionJob Title: Digital Technical SpecialistLocation: Peoria, ILVisa: AnyDuration: 12+ Months ContractPrimary Skills:Snowflake, Grafana, AWS Cloud Formation, API, Technical SupportDescription:The Digital Technical Specialist is responsible for monitoring overall performance of assigned digital products and handling customer issues through...


  • Peoria, Illinois, United States Next Level Business Services, Inc. Full time

    Job SummaryThe ideal candidate will possess a strong background in IT, with a focus on technical solutions and project management. This role will involve coordinating work with others, managing assignments, and ensuring timely completion of tasks.Key responsibilities will include:Managing and coordinating work assignmentsCoordinating with team members to...


  • Peoria, United States FILANC Full time

    DEssential Functions:Provide administrative and project support to the Arizona R&M General Manager, Project Managers, Field Superintendents and Field Employees as needed with confidentiality and professionalism. Responsibilities:Office AdministrationManage all calls and correspondence for the Arizona office.Check and sort mail daily.Receive and ship...


  • Peoria, Illinois, United States Randstad Full time

    Job Summary:The Digital Technical Analyst is responsible for monitoring overall performance of assigned digital products and handling customer issues through resolution. This role requires a strong understanding of relational databases, cloud computing, and high availability architecture.Responsibilities: Triage and resolve support tickets as per the defined...


  • Peoria, Illinois, United States Goli Tech Full time

    Job OverviewWe are seeking a highly skilled Digital Technical Support Specialist to join our team at Goli Tech. The successful candidate will be responsible for monitoring the performance of assigned digital products and resolving customer issues in a timely and efficient manner.Key Responsibilities:Triage and resolve support tickets in accordance with our...


  • Peoria, United States Next Level Business Services, Inc. Full time

    The position manages the completion of its own work assignments and coordinates work with others. Based on past experiences and knowledge, the incumbent normally works independently with minimal management input and review of end results. Typical customers include Caterpillar customers, dealers, other external companies who purchase services offered by...


  • Peoria, Illinois, United States Randstad Full time

    Job Summary:The Digital Technical Analyst is responsible for monitoring overall performance of assigned digital products and handling customer issues through resolution.Key Responsibilities:Triage and resolve support tickets as per the defined Service Level agreementWork on critical application/technical problem identification and resolution, including...


  • Peoria, Arizona, United States Illinois Central College Full time

    Job SummaryThe TRIO SSS Administrative Assistant will provide administrative support to the TRIO SSS Program at Illinois Central College. This role requires a friendly and professional demeanor, with the ability to maintain confidentiality and work independently.Key ResponsibilitiesAssist with preparing team meetings, reports, and other materialsComplete the...


  • Peoria, Illinois, United States Caterpillar Full time

    Job Title: IT Analyst III-ApplicationsCaterpillar Inc. is seeking a highly skilled IT Analyst III-Applications to join its team. As a key member of the data analytics group, you will work closely with developers, customers, and digital architects to bring data to the platform through ETL or SQL development.Key Responsibilities:Develop and maintain the...


  • Peoria, Illinois, United States VETERANS HEALTH ADMINISTRATION Full time

    Job SummaryThe VETERANS HEALTH ADMINISTRATION is seeking a highly skilled Medical Support Assistant to join our team. As a Medical Support Assistant, you will play a critical role in providing administrative support to our healthcare team, ensuring the smooth operation of our clinic and providing exceptional patient care.Key ResponsibilitiesCoordinate with...


  • Peoria, Illinois, United States Caterpillar Full time

    Career Opportunity: As a Data Governance Specialist at Caterpillar Inc., you will play a critical role in shaping the company's data management strategy. You will work closely with developers, customers, and digital architects to bring data to the platform through ETL or SQL development. Your focus will be on developing and maintaining the governance frame...


  • Peoria, United States Artists ReEnvisioning Tomorrow Inc Full time

    Organization Description Artists ReEnvisioning Tomorrow Inc "ART Inc", founded in 2018 by Jonathon and Nikki Romain, is Peoria's foremost arts education non-profit organization. ART Inc provides arts education opportunities to nearly 500 students and teaching artists each year. The staff, board, volunteers, and teaching artists of ART Inc work tirelessly to...

  • Data Scientist

    4 weeks ago


    Peoria, Illinois, United States Caterpillar Full time

    About the Role:Caterpillar is seeking a Data Scientist to join our Earthmoving Division, a multi-billion dollar division. As a Data Scientist, you will be responsible for developing analytical tools to provide valuable financial and operational insights to Senior Leadership.Key Responsibilities:Directing the data gathering, data mining, and data processing...